Drop a mosquito dunk in a pond or rainbarrel and it will kill larvae with a natural bacillus that targets mosquitoes not fish pets or people.

Oils in general like vegetable oil or olive oil can be a way to kill mosquito larvae because they coat the surface of the water suffocating the larvae recall that they dont have gills.
